Who we’re looking for

We’re looking for international students who have successfully completed either the International Foundation Year, or the International Year One, qualification through and approved NCUK Study Centre, and who are intending to study at Massey University and live on campus in a Massey Hall of Residence.

What you’ll be studying

These are undergraduate scholarships. You will be intending to enrol full time in a degree programme at Massey’s Albany, Manawatu or Wellington campus.

Eligibility criteria

You must have:

  • successfully completed one year at an approved NCUK Study Centre
  • secured an admission offer of place
  • made an application to live on campus

Application checklist

Include the following with your application:

  • a personal statement advising why you wish to live on campus, and what you will contribute to the student community by residing on campus
  • a copy of your academic transcripts for your qualification completed at a NCUK Study Centre

Selection considerations

When choosing our recipients we will consider your academic achievements and proposed contribution to the student community.
